Synonyms
A measure of heat energy used for heaters and air conditioners
A unit of heat equal to the amount needed to raise one pound of water by one degree Fahrenheit
A unit of energy used to measure the heat or cooling power of fuels and heaters like air conditioners

Morphology
The phrase is compositionally built from 'British' + 'thermal' + 'unit', so a learner who knows the constituents can infer it denotes a unit for measuring heat associated with the British/imperial system. However, the precise technical definition (the specific quantity: one pound of water by one degree Fahrenheit at one atmosphere) is specialized domain knowledge that a B1 learner would not derive from the parts alone, so it is only partially predictable.
Etymology
British thermal unit comes from engineers in Britain who wanted a simple measure of heat; they chose the amount of heat needed to warm one pound of water by one degree Fahrenheit. That's why the words British, thermal and unit show that it is a standard 'heat' measure, and why a British thermal unit is still used to rate heaters and air conditioners.
